Output 9e58370b1acd2b8174ec80feacdea2b41930b034d092311528d60cbeca8ede5c:1

value
8743930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b43f3aa8ca6a949ef352018b01170274d95382 OP_EQUAL
address
3EhZoZfbQvCHYbrep2xF9YbtysWRdJmHBC
transaction
9e58370b1acd2b8174ec80feacdea2b41930b034d092311528d60cbeca8ede5c
confirmations
84597
spent
true